Output 106328678e4daa77f7bb846ea16f1aa859c3723fde4d6afad01e9a3ff5df630f:1

value
1471120622
script pubkey
OP_0 OP_PUSHBYTES_20 1de1663991d3746f05d014526868f486fe2c24fa
address
bc1qrhskvwv36d6x7pwsz3fxs685smlzcf86m5dt7k
transaction
106328678e4daa77f7bb846ea16f1aa859c3723fde4d6afad01e9a3ff5df630f
confirmations
327225
spent
true